Description
French New Wave film-maker Agnès Varda directs this drama exploring the complex and devastating effects of an extra-marital affair. François (Jean-Claude Drouot), a happily-married carpenter with a young family, finds himself falling in love with telephone operator Emilie (Marie-France Boyer). As he basks in the joy and passion of his new relationship, he finds that far from feeling alienated from his family, his feelings for them are actually enhanced and intensified.
But when he tries to share his joyful discovery with his wife, her reaction is far from the delight that François hoped for.
